Job Purpose:

This position is responsible for the preparation and facilitation of educational programs for associates through the following communication methods: in person, online, webinar and video. Topics include customer service, product knowledge, sales, regulatory, corporate initiatives, role specific training as well as computer training and other topics. Implement strategies to validate successful adoption of skills and knowledge of training presentations. Will train and educate current and new Learning and Development team members on delivery techniques that align with instructional design.

Job Duties: Delivers group and individual instruction and training covering a range of technical, operational, and/or management areas in a specific area of the bank

  • Develops training curricula and/or recommends or utilizes vendor programs that meet instructional goals and objectives
  • Formulates training agendas and determines instructional methods, utilizing knowledge of specified training needs and effectiveness of such methods as individual training or group instruction
  • Select, develop and create training aids, including training handbooks, demonstration models, multimedia visual aids, computer tutorials, and reference works
  • Coordinate or perform administrative functions necessary to deliver and document training programs
  • Evaluates effectiveness of training and development programs; utilizes relevant evaluation data to revise or recommend changes in instructional objectives and methods
  • Assists in analyzing and assessing training to develop the needs for individuals and/groups
  • Answer phone calls and questions to support continued training needs
  • Develop and update written procedures.
  • Work on detailed projects, lead discussions, and conduct further training for associates regarding the role
  • Establish strong time management to balance training responsibilities along with new project initiatives
  • Perform detailed administration to the learning management system including reporting and robust creation content
  • Continuously pursue new ways to create training to keep audience engaged to learn new information
  • Providing guidance and support to other training staff, including new trainers, on instructional design and delivery techniques.
  • Implementing strategies to ensure successful adoption of new skills and knowledge acquired through training for changes.
  • Will perform special projects as assigned.

Normal hours are 8:00am to 5:00pm, Monday - Friday, some evening and weekend hours will be required based on projects and needs for training.

Education, Experience and Job Skills:

  • Bachelor's degree or a minimum of an associate's degree with three to five or more years banking experience
  • Ability to work with multiple individuals within the organization
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ment with a high degree of accuracy and close attention to detail
  • Proven team player
  • Intermediate knowledge of Microsoft Suite of programs
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to prioritize and effectively manage time to meet deadlines
  • Positive and professional attitude in an open, team environment
  • Will work in client facing environments on periodic basis
  • Up to 50% travel required for the position
  • Must be able to lift up to 20 lbs.
